Oasis+ summary

The objective of OASIS+ (One Acquisition Solution for Integrated Services Plus) is to provide Government agencies with total integrated solutions for a multitude of services-based requirements on a global basis.

Although considered a follow-up of OASIS, this new contracting vehicle has expanded the its scope to include functional areas from GSA’s other government-wide contract vehicle solutions, such as BMO (Building, Maintenance and Operations) and HCaTS (Human Capital and Training Solutions). It is is available for use by all Federal agencies and other entities as listed in GSA Order ADM 4800.2I, Eligibility to Use GSA Sources of Supply and Service as amended.

Pools:
OASIS+ will group service offerings within Domains that follow a category management structure.
Domains:
  1. Management and Advisory
  2. Technical and Engineering
  3. Research and Development
  4. Intelligence Services
  5. Enterprise Solutions
  6. Environmental Services
  7. Facilities
  8. Logistics
Partnering: Joint Ventures and CTAs (Prime/Sub) are allowed
Evaluation: To receive a Domain award, the offer must meet or exceed a specified qualification threshold. The Offeror has the discretion to use any combination of qualifications detailed in the qualification matrix to achieve the threshold.

The qualifications matrix includes both project experience and other relevant qualifications (e.g., corporate level qualifications, applicable certifications). The relative weighting of criteria are designed to ensure all awardees are capable of providing high quality, best-in-class services to support the range of requirements anticipated, based on comprehensive customer feedback about the criteria’s benefit to the Government.

To the maximum extent possible, qualifying criteria will be standardized across Domains to minimize the burden to industry. Domain-specific factors focus on mission critical requirements for that Domain’s scope.).

Evaluation Criteria

To receive a Domain award, the offer must meet or exceed a specified qualification threshold. The Offeror has the discretion to use any combination of qualifications detailed in the qualification matrix to achieve the threshold. The qualifications matrix includes both project experience and other relevant qualifications (e.g., corporate level qualifications, applicable certifications).

Ultimately, the Offeror is responsible for clearly demonstrating that the claimed criteria are met. GSA will remove from consideration any proposal element where the Offeror does not clearly demonstrate that the claimed criteria is met, based on being non-responsive (non-compliant) to the solicitation requirements.

OASIS+ Enrollment & Awards

According to GSA, OASIS Plus (OASIS+) will be an open enrollment opportunity, with the intention of enrolling more contractors. GSA intends to award separate IDIQ contracts under each of the following categories:

  • 8(a) small business
  • HUBZone small business
  • Service-disabled veteran-owned small business
  • Total small business
  • Women-owned small business
  • Unrestricted

Qualification standards for each IDIQ will be designed to achieve targeted socioeconomic representation. Unrestricted solicitations may require a higher qualifying threshold and additional qualifying criteria, such as: past performance exceeding subcontracting goals, gre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disclosures, experience performing IAW applicable labor laws (e.g., Service Contract Labor Standards, Collective Bargaining Agreements), experience with and/or plan to support other priorities (e.g., AbilityOne and minority-owned SBs).

Proposal Preparation

GSA OASIS Plus (OASIS+) is a Self-Scoring solicitation, meaning bidders score themselves on one or more factors according to the evaluation criteria (or evaluation matrix) and provide documentation to support their assertions. To succeed in this endeavored:

  1. a bidder must understand the qualification requirements and evaluation criteria
  2. recognize its qualifications that best match the requirements and achieve the highest score
  3. gather and provide documentation and evidence to substantiate those qualifications

Compared to other solicitations, in self-scoring solicitations each bidder must do the work of both a bidder and a contracting officer at the same time.
